Output 681c6ecccc4eb2bfb51ab628316adde1ae3bf7ecadd0fd7228c79e2c73274280:5

value
143120000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f42d3acdf43ebae2d07f82858b198864d0c1ef19 OP_EQUAL
address
MWAFHrMm2BsNQSjguajLZyHAEVorV5qP9p
transaction
681c6ecccc4eb2bfb51ab628316adde1ae3bf7ecadd0fd7228c79e2c73274280
spent
true